Result Based Financing Facility – Uganda Energy Credit

Grant support is linked to verifiable outputs to help private energy companies enter the solar and clean cooking businesses and take the risk of serving consumers especially in hard to reach areas.

Uganda Launches Results-Based Financing Programme to Boost

The Government of Uganda has officially launched its Results-Based Financing/Price Subsidy (RBF) Programme, a key component of the Electricity Access Scale-up Project (EASP).
